PrestoLinkedService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Servicio vinculado del servidor presto.
[Microsoft.Rest.Serialization.JsonTransformation]
[Newtonsoft.Json.JsonObject("Presto")]
public class PrestoLinkedService : Microsoft.Azure.Management.DataFactory.Models.LinkedService
[<Microsoft.Rest.Serialization.JsonTransformation>]
[<Newtonsoft.Json.JsonObject("Presto")>]
type PrestoLinkedService = class
inherit LinkedService
Public Class PrestoLinkedService
Inherits LinkedService
- Herencia
- Atributos
-
JsonTransformationAttribute Newtonsoft.Json.JsonObjectAttribute
Constructores
PrestoLinkedService() |
Inicializa una nueva instancia de la clase PrestoLinkedService. |
PrestoLinkedService(Object, Object, Object, String, IDictionary<String, Object>, IntegrationRuntimeReference, String, IDictionary<String, ParameterSpecification>, IList<Object>, Object, Object, SecretBase, Object, Object, Object, Object, Object, Object, Object) |
Inicializa una nueva instancia de la clase PrestoLinkedService. |
Propiedades
AdditionalProperties |
Obtiene o establece propiedades no coincidentes del mensaje se deserializan en esta colección. (Heredado de LinkedService) |
AllowHostNameCNMismatch |
Obtiene o establece especifica si se debe requerir un nombre de certificado SSL emitido por la entidad de certificación para que coincida con el nombre de host del servidor al conectarse a través de SSL. El valor predeterminado es false. |
AllowSelfSignedServerCert |
Obtiene o establece especifica si se permiten certificados autofirmados desde el servidor. El valor predeterminado es false. |
Annotations |
Obtiene o establece la lista de etiquetas que se pueden usar para describir el servicio vinculado. (Heredado de LinkedService) |
AuthenticationType |
Obtiene o establece el mecanismo de autenticación utilizado para conectarse al servidor de Presto. Entre los valores posibles se incluyen: "Anonymous", "LDAP" |
Catalog |
Obtiene o establece el contexto de catálogo para todas las solicitudes en el servidor. |
ConnectVia |
Obtiene o establece la referencia de Integration Runtime. (Heredado de LinkedService) |
Description |
Obtiene o establece la descripción del servicio vinculado. (Heredado de LinkedService) |
EnableSsl |
Obtiene o establece especifica si las conexiones al servidor se cifran mediante SSL. El valor predeterminado es false. |
EncryptedCredential |
Obtiene o establece la credencial cifrada usada para la autenticación. Las credenciales se cifran mediante el administrador de credenciales de Integration Runtime. Tipo: cadena (o Expresión con cadena resultType). |
Host |
Obtiene o establece la dirección IP o el nombre de host del servidor de Presto. (es decir, 192.168.222.160) |
Parameters |
Obtiene o establece parámetros para el servicio vinculado. (Heredado de LinkedService) |
Password |
Obtiene o establece la contraseña correspondiente al nombre de usuario. |
Port |
Obtiene o establece el puerto TCP que usa el servidor Presto para escuchar las conexiones de cliente. El valor predeterminado es 8080. |
ServerVersion |
Obtiene o establece la versión del servidor Presto. (es decir, 0.148-t) |
TimeZoneID |
Obtiene o establece la zona horaria local utilizada por la conexión. Los valores válidos para esta opción se especifican en la base de datos de la zona horaria IANA. El valor predeterminado es la zona horaria del sistema. |
TrustedCertPath |
Obtiene o establece la ruta de acceso completa del archivo .pem que contiene certificados de CA de confianza para comprobar el servidor al conectarse a través de SSL. Esta propiedad solo puede establecerse al utilizar SSL en IR autohospedados. El valor predeterminado es el archivo cacerts.pem instalado con el IR. |
Username |
Obtiene o establece el nombre de usuario utilizado para conectarse al servidor de Presto. |
UseSystemTrustStore |
Obtiene o establece especifica si se debe usar un certificado de ENTIDAD de certificación del almacén de confianza del sistema o de un archivo PEM especificado. El valor predeterminado es false. |
Métodos
Validate() |
Valide el objeto . |
Se aplica a
Azure SDK for .NET